We have a client that has an Access Database they use for all of there client information. This was created many years ago in Microsoft Access 2003. 2 Years ago, we split the database to allow for multiple users, so there is now a front end and a back end database.
For 2 Years it was working fine, up until about a week ago. Now, pretty much every 2 hours, the database will go inconsistent. The only way to fix it is to compact and repair, which has a chance of removing some data from the back end database.
I require someone who is well versed in Microsoft Access Databases who can investigate the reason for the inconsistency issue and fix it.
